Prayer for the Beatification of the Servant of God Sister Lucia

Most Holy Trinity, Father, Son and Holy Spirit, I adore you profoundly and I thank you for the Apparitions of the Blessed Virgin Mary in Fatima, that revealed to the world the riches of her Immaculate Heart. By the infinite merits of the Sacred Heart of Jesus and through the intercession of the Immaculate Heart of Mary, I implore You, if it should be for Your greater glory and the good of our souls, to glorify Sr. Lucy, one of the Shepherds of Fatima, by granting us the grace which we implore through her intercession (the total healing of 4 year old Christina Thomas from a terminal brain tumor).
Amen.
Our Father, Hail Mary, Glory Be.
